Bitcoin (BTC) briefly dipped beneath $100,000 on Monday after Iran launched assaults on United States army bases in Qatar. Though the value rebounded to $108,000 by Wednesday, sentiment within the BTC derivatives markets has turned cautious, suggesting merchants are much less assured about additional upside. However are there legitimate causes for this worry of a Bitcoin worth crash?
On Wednesday, the Bitcoin perpetual contracts funding fee dropped to its lowest stage in seven weeks. In impartial markets, lengthy positions usually pay to keep up leverage, so unfavourable charges are unusual. Apparently, this occurred at the same time as Bitcoin rallied to $108,000.
Reasonably than focusing solely on the implications, reminiscent of waning demand for leveraged positions, it’s important to think about attainable causes for bearish funding charges. A part of the erosion in confidence stems from the worldwide commerce warfare initiated by the US in April. Whereas short-term truces have been established, some are nearing expiration, together with the settlement with the eurozone, set to lapse on July 9.
US President Donald Trump has been broadly criticized for reversing course throughout commerce negotiations. In response to a Washington Put up analyst, the Trump administration has revamped 50 tariff coverage adjustments since he took workplace. Because of this, buyers are more and more involved that the commerce battle might intensify.
Tariffs, AI hype and declining Bitcoin miner profitability
Including to the unease, the US gross home product posted a 0.5% year-over-year decline within the first quarter, primarily based on ultimate official figures launched Thursday. CNN attributed the surprising contraction to an enormous commerce deficit, as North American corporations ramped up inventories forward of anticipated tariff hikes.
Regardless of this, Bitcoin merchants are pissed off that US small-cap shares have proven resilience whereas BTC stays effectively beneath the $112,000 mark.
The Russell 2000 index, which excludes the 1,000 largest US-listed corporations, surged to a four-month excessive. Since many buyers nonetheless classify Bitcoin as a risk-on asset, fears surrounding “reckless synthetic intelligence spending driving sky-high valuations” have acted as a ceiling for Bitcoin’s worth.
Gartner Consulting analysts famous that “most agentic AI tasks proper now are early-stage experiments or proofs-of-concept which can be principally pushed by hype and are sometimes misapplied,” as reported by Yahoo Finance. Consequently, with a extra cautious investor posture, some profit-taking above $105,000 is to be anticipated.

One other supply of threat comes from the rising variety of corporations which have added Bitcoin to their stability sheets. An surprising transfer occurred as Bit Digital (BTBT), a New York-based Bitcoin mining firm listed on Nasdaq, introduced Wednesday its intention to divest its mining infrastructure and BTC holdings to buy Ether (ETH) as a substitute.
As of March 31, Bit Digital held 24,434 ETH and 417.6 BTC in reserves. This growth has raised fears that different miners might also liquidate their BTC positions, particularly since mining revenues have fallen to a two-month low, in accordance with a CryptoQuant report.
Whereas macroeconomic situations nonetheless assist a possible Bitcoin all-time excessive, given the rising strain on central banks to undertake free financial insurance policies. Therefore, the specter of a short lived correction beneath $100,000 stays an actual chance.
